| | | Sec. 3. 5 MRSA §13058, sub-§10-A is enacted to read: |
|
| | | 10-A.__ Maine Downtown Center.__The commissioner shall | | establish the Maine Downtown Center, referred to in this | | subsection as the "center," within the department to encourage | | downtown revitalization in the State. |
|
| | | A.__The center serves the following functions: |
|
| | | (1) To advocate for downtown revitalization; |
|
| | | (2) To promote awareness about the importance of vital | | downtowns; |
|
| | | (3) To serve as a clearinghouse for information | | relating to downtown development; and |
|
| | | (4) To provide training and technical assistance to | | communities that demonstrate a willingness and ability | | to revitalize their downtowns. |
|
| | | B.__The commissioner shall appoint a director of the center | | who shall administer the center in accordance with the | | policies of the commissioner and the provisions of this | | subsection. |
|
| | | C.__The commissioner shall collaborate with the Director of | | the State Planning Office within the Executive Department to | | coordinate the programs of the center. |
|
| | | D.__For the purposes of this subsection, "downtown" means | | the traditional central business district of a community | | that has served as the center for socioeconomic interaction | | in the community and is characterized by a cohesive core of | | commercial and mixed-use buildings, often interspersed with | | civic, religious and residential buildings and public | | spaces, typically arranged along a main street and | | intersecting side streets, walkable and served by public | | infrastructure. |
